Standout Feature

GHX Exchange: The world's largest healthcare supply chain network enabling real-time e-commerce, automated ordering, and standardized data exchange.

GHX is a comprehensive supply chain management platform tailored for healthcare, connecting hospitals, suppliers, and distributors to streamline procurement, inventory management, and spend analytics. It facilitates automated purchasing through its vast B2B marketplace, which processes billions in transactions annually, while providing advanced tools for contract compliance, data insights, and cost optimization. Designed specifically for the complexities of hospital supply chains, GHX helps reduce costs, improve efficiency, and ensure regulatory adherence.

Standout Feature

Guided picking workflows with single-point accountability and RFID-enabled accurate dispensing to minimize errors and diversion.

BD Pyxis SupplyStation is an automated supply management system from Becton Dickinson (BD) designed for hospitals to optimize inventory control, dispensing, and replenishment of medical supplies. It uses secure, networked cabinets with barcode or RFID technology to enable real-time tracking, par-level optimization, expiration date management, and usage analytics. The platform integrates with electronic health records (EHR) and en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ems to improve charge capture, reduce waste, and ensure compliance in high-volume healthcare environments.

Standout Feature

Oracle Intelligent Track and Trace for real-time, end-to-end visibility and automated compliance tracking across the supply chain

Oracle Supply Chain Management (SCM) is a comprehensive cloud-based platform designed for end-to-end supply chain orchestration, including procurement, inventory management, order fulfillment, and logistics. In the context of hospital supply chain management, it excels in tracking medical supplies, pharmaceuticals, and equipment with real-time visibility, demand forecasting, and supplier collaboration. While not exclusively tailored for healthcare, it supports compliance needs through customizable workflows and integrates with Oracle Health solutions for enhanced hospital operations.
